The 2020–21 football season is the 15th season of football on Micras since the foundation of the FMF, which started on 1 September 2020 and will end on 31 August 2021. The season is a World Cup year.

Transfers
Two transfer windows were opened for the 2020–21 season in which permanent and loan moves could be finalised: a summer preseason window, opened between 1 June 2020 and 30 September 2020, and a winter mid-season window, opened throughout the entirety of January 2021.
